Автор Тема: Денвер.  (Прочитано 8109 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Alex_shaman

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 12
  • +0/-0
  • 0
    • Просмотр профиля
    • http://ut.ugracom.ru/dir/index.html
Денвер.
« : 24 Января 2005, 06:25:22 »
На машине под Win XP установлен базовый пакет Денвер2.
Поставил Sanitarium? настроил, но вот какая проблема: при переходе с основной страницы на прочтение полного сообщения

появляется пустая страничка с таким cообщением ---> Вы ошиблись при наборе URL в браузере. Вероятнее всего, сервер

пытается найти файл z:/home/weblog.ru/www/www/1/1_1.html, которого не существует.
На самом деле он сгенерирован и лежит там где надо, но почему то скрипт пишет путь как

z:/home/weblog.ru/www/www/1/1_1.html
с двумя папками www откуда вторая wwwd появляется вадресе не вкурю никак... проверил пути в cfg все правильно?
Может Денвер глючит?
« Последнее редактирование: 24 Января 2005, 06:40:00 от Alex_shaman »

Оффлайн Wrong

  • Завсегдатай
  • Пользователь
  • **
  • Сообщений: 51
  • +0/-0
  • 0
    • Просмотр профиля
    • http://lineband.nm.ru
Денвер.
« Ответ #1 : 24 Января 2005, 10:08:21 »
в путях что то напутал..
я юзал денвер..тестил много чего и Сан. тоже..все нормально.

Оффлайн Green Kakadu

  • Координатор
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 2757
  • +1/-0
  • 0
    • Просмотр профиля
    • http://gnezdo.webscript.ru
Денвер.
« Ответ #2 : 24 Января 2005, 11:41:50 »
Цитировать
Alex_shaman:
На самом деле он сгенерирован и лежит там где надо, но почему то скрипт пишет путь как

z:/home/weblog.ru/www/www/1/1_1.html

ни разу с денвером не имел дела, но.. почему вместо урла - пишется путь??? Может стоит всетаки в $public_url написать урл, а не путь, типа http://weblog.ru??

ЗЫ на всякий пожарный: файлы БД с данными с Win на Unix сервер не перенесутся, т.е. единственный смысл запуска санитара на локальной машине - настроить шаблоны
 в исканиях.

Оффлайн Alex_shaman

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 12
  • +0/-0
  • 0
    • Просмотр профиля
    • http://ut.ugracom.ru/dir/index.html
Денвер.
« Ответ #3 : 24 Января 2005, 19:47:49 »
Не на самаом деле все выглядит так --->
вот директория где лежат скрипты в Денвере



далее захожу в admin tool: создаю категорию, автора, пишу статью.
жму регенирация всей системы и перехожу по ссылке



хотя при наведении курсра мыши на ссылку путь правильный указан



а Денвер выдает следующее:



вот строки из файла cfg.cfg ---->

#_____________________
#_____ABOUT YOUR SITE:

#Site name, eq $site_title=\'Test Web Log\';
$site_title=\'weblog.ru\';

#Not Found Page - visitors view this page if required page not found
#Example: $not_found=\'http://webscript.ru/404.html\';
#You must create this page - script only redirect to it, not create!
$not_found=\'http://weblog.ru/www/404.html\';

#URL Your WebLoG Main Index Page
#Example: $index_url=\'http://webscript.ru/sanitarium\';
$index_url=\'http://weblog.ru/www/index.html\';

#Sendmail - ask your hosting-provider
#Most popular sendmail paths: /usr/lib/sendmail, /usr/sbin/sendmail
$SEND_MAIL=\'/usr/sbin/sendmail\';

#Administrator E-mail address
#Example: $admin_mail=\'mymail@site.com\';
$admin_mail=\'webstyle@stsland.ru\';#! Change this!

 далее пропущу и пути --->


#_______________________________
#____SANITARIUM PATHs AND URLs:


# Public PATH and URL of Pages (and weblog index page) to be built. No Trailing Slash.
#Example:
# $public_dir=\'/HTTP/www/public_html/ezine\';
# $public_url=\'http://webscript.ru/ezine\';

$public_dir=\'/home/weblog.ru/www\';
$public_url=\'http://weblog.ru/www\';

# PATH and URL of Admin CGI directory. No Trailing Slash.
#Store there: admin.cgi, Sanitarium_WL.pm, cfg.cfg, Comment_WL, upload.cgi, lang.pl
# com_admin.cgi and script data.
#Example:
#$dir=\'/HTTP/www/cgi-bin/sanitarium/admin\';
# Other Files: view.cgi, comments.cgi input in top dir or something else (eq into: /HTTP/www/cgi-bin/sanitarium)
$dir=\'/home/weblog.ru/cgi-bin/admin\';

#view.cgi url
#Example: $view_cgi_url=\'http://webscript.ru/cgi-bin/2log/view.cgi\';
$view_cgi_url=\'http://weblog.ru/cgi-bin/view.cgi\';

#admin.cgi URL
#Example: $script_admin=\'http://webscript.ru/cgi-bin/sanitarium/admin/admin.cgi\';
$script_admin=\'http://weblog.ru/cgi-bin/admin/admin.cgi\';

#com_admin.cgi URL:
#Example: $comadmin_cgi_url=\'http://webscript.ru/cgi-bin/sanitarium/admin/com_admin.cgi\';
$comadmin_cgi_url=\'http://weblog.ru/cgi-bin/admin/com_admin.cgi\';

#comments.cgi URL:
#Example: $comment_url=\'http://webscript.ru/cgi-bin/sanitarium/comments.cgi\';
$comment_url=\'http://weblog.ru/cgi-bin/comments.cgi\';

#upload.cgi URL:
#Example:
$upload_url=\'http://weblog.ru/cgi-bin/admin/upload.cgi\';

Что здесь не так не пойму...
« Последнее редактирование: 24 Января 2005, 20:30:20 от Alex_shaman »

Оффлайн Green Kakadu

  • Координатор
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 2757
  • +1/-0
  • 0
    • Просмотр профиля
    • http://gnezdo.webscript.ru
Денвер.
« Ответ #4 : 24 Января 2005, 21:07:12 »
Цитировать
Alex_shaman:
$index_url=\'http://weblog.ru/www/index.html\';
\\
напиши http://weblog.ru/www
а ты смотрел, там сами файлы есть?
Может у тебя расширение не *html а *htm?
$ext=\'html\';
$index_page=\'index.html\';
 в исканиях.

Оффлайн Alex_shaman

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 12
  • +0/-0
  • 0
    • Просмотр профиля
    • http://ut.ugracom.ru/dir/index.html
Денвер.
« Ответ #5 : 24 Января 2005, 21:40:05 »
Файлы на месте лежат z:\\WebServers\\home\\weblog.ru\\www\\index.html, расширение  *html

$ext=\'html\';
$index_page=\'index.html\';

Оффлайн Alex_shaman

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 12
  • +0/-0
  • 0
    • Просмотр профиля
    • http://ut.ugracom.ru/dir/index.html
Денвер.
« Ответ #6 : 24 Января 2005, 21:50:54 »
Поменял в сfg $index_url=\'http://weblog.ru/www/index.html\';
на                  $index_url=\'http://weblog.ru/www/\';

тоже самое, причем пишет /www/www/ откуда вторая www берется?
Вы ошиблись при наборе URL в браузере. Вероятнее всего, сервер пытается найти файл z:/home/weblog.ru/www/www/index.html, которого не существует.

Оффлайн Alex_shaman

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 12
  • +0/-0
  • 0
    • Просмотр профиля
    • http://ut.ugracom.ru/dir/index.html
Денвер.
« Ответ #7 : 24 Января 2005, 22:02:20 »
Всё нашел выход... В строке

#URL Your WebLoG Main Index Page
#Example: $index_url=\'http://webscript.ru/sanitarium\';
$index_url=\'http://weblog.ru/www/index.html\';

поменял на
 
#URL Your WebLoG Main Index Page
#Example: $index_url=\'http://webscript.ru/sanitarium\';
$index_url=\'http://weblog.ru/index.html\';

а в строке

$public_dir=\'/home/weblog.ru/www\';
$public_url=\'http://weblog.ru/www\';

поменял так

$public_dir=\'/home/weblog.ru/www\';
$public_url=\'http://weblog.ru\';

Всё заработало как часики, спасибо за комментарии, буду чаще бывать у вас.

Оффлайн Alex_shaman

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 12
  • +0/-0
  • 0
    • Просмотр профиля
    • http://ut.ugracom.ru/dir/index.html
Денвер.
« Ответ #8 : 24 Января 2005, 22:12:33 »
Может у кого с Денвером 2 такие проблемы возникали?

Оффлайн Alex_shaman

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 12
  • +0/-0
  • 0
    • Просмотр профиля
    • http://ut.ugracom.ru/dir/index.html
Денвер.
« Ответ #9 : 24 Января 2005, 22:15:12 »
Цитировать
Wrong:
в путях что то напутал..
я юзал денвер..тестил много чего и Сан. тоже..все нормально.

 
Я прописывал пути исходя из инструкции, а вот получилось так, см. выше. :)

Оффлайн Alex_shaman

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 12
  • +0/-0
  • 0
    • Просмотр профиля
    • http://ut.ugracom.ru/dir/index.html
Денвер.
« Ответ #10 : 25 Января 2005, 02:44:24 »
И еще вопрос. Создал 4 категории в 2-х из них есть статьи, а в  2-х других статей нет.
Должен ли в папках последних категорий  создаваться файл index.html без статей или нет? Если нет то при переходе по ссылке на категорию, где нет статей и файла index.html  должен ли быть переход на файл 404.html который лежит в \'http://weblog.ru/www/404.html\'; ?
У меня ни того ни другого не генерируется...
Жду ответа.

Оффлайн Fargus

  • Завсегдатай
  • Новичок
  • *
  • Сообщений: 31
  • +0/-0
  • 0
    • Просмотр профиля
    • http://
Денвер.
« Ответ #11 : 25 Января 2005, 13:52:23 »
Цитировать
И еще вопрос. Создал 4 категории в 2-х из них есть статьи, а в 2-х других статей нет.
Должен ли в папках последних категорий создаваться файл index.html без статей или нет? Если нет то при переходе по ссылке на категорию, где нет статей и файла index.html должен ли быть переход на файл 404.html который лежит в \'http://weblog.ru/www/404.html\'; ?
У меня ни того ни другого не генерируется...
Жду ответа.


Это нормально. Пока нет хотя бы одной статьи в категории, будет выдавать ошибку. А чтобы выскакивала 404 ошибка положи в корень файл .htaccess:

ErrorDocument 400 http://myDomain/www/error400.html
ErrorDocument 401 http://myDomain/www/error401.html
ErrorDocument 403 http://myDomain/www/error403.html
ErrorDocument 404 http://myDomain/www/error404.html
ErrorDocument 500 http://myDomain/www/error500.html

Оффлайн Green Kakadu

  • Координатор
  • Глобальный модератор
  • Ветеран
  • *****
  • Сообщений: 2757
  • +1/-0
  • 0
    • Просмотр профиля
    • http://gnezdo.webscript.ru
Денвер.
« Ответ #12 : 25 Января 2005, 13:59:55 »
Цитировать
Fargus:
Это нормально. Пока нет хотя бы одной статьи в категории, будет выдавать ошибку. А чтобы выскакивала 404 ошибка положи в корень файл .htaccess:

наиболее разумный способ
Тот error 404, что в конфиге написан выдается при динамич.режиме работы (всякие там поиски и т.д.)
 в исканиях.

Оффлайн Alex_shaman

  • Заглянувший
  • Новичок
  • *
  • Сообщений: 12
  • +0/-0
  • 0
    • Просмотр профиля
    • http://ut.ugracom.ru/dir/index.html
Денвер.
« Ответ #13 : 25 Января 2005, 15:37:36 »
Благодарю всех!

 

Sitemap 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28